Jan, 2015 gecko media plugin sandbox escape announced january, 2015 reporter nils impact critical products firefox fixed in. If nothing happens, download github desktop and try again. Find related downloads to gecko browser freeware and softwares, download kmeleon, spark baidu browser, torch browser, tor browser, avant browser, maxthon cloud. First, mozilla is a nonprofit organization with a mission is to promote openness and innovation on the web. Consumers use the browser that ships with the device, simple as that. Firefox is officially available for windows 7 or newer, macos, and linux. After that, you need to download the xulrunner runtime from mozilla website, it is very important that you download a version from here that matches the same. Gecko is designed to support open internet standards, and is used by different applications to display web pages and, in some cases, an. Mozilla firefox, or simply firefox, is a free and opensource web browser developed by the mozilla foundation and its subsidiary, mozilla corporation. The download manager was just a revolution for my part, themes was so cool and adons where everywhere. The mozilla environment is made of gecko, xulrunner and firefox or firefox os. This move is the first step in testing geckoview massively. Offline mode is a feature of firefox that allows you to view cached w. New firefox focus comes with search suggestions, revamped.
This chapter provides basic setup information for the gecko software. Ff4 brought a new ui, sync and support for html5 and css3. Quantum project based on a crazy fast servo engine revamped. The titles of the festival revolve around the main theme, freedom as in. The article fails to point that geckoview firefox focus nightly isnt the same as gecko firefox android, firefox desktop prequantum and of course different from webview android built in, current firefox focus and quantum firefox desktop.
In 2017, firefox began incorporating new technology under the code name quantum to promote parallelism and a more intuitive user. Choose which firefox browser to download in your language everyone deserves access to the internet your language should never be a barrier. Apr 29, 2018 to launch firefox with selenium geckodriver, you will first need to download geckodriver and then set its path. According to this link, for firefox 45 and 46, start driver code could look like this. A debug message, useful for debugging but too verbose to be turned on. For now, if youd like to learn more about the future of our privacy browser, please have a look at this post on the mozilla hacks blog. To launch firefox with selenium geckodriver, you will first need to download geckodriver and then set its path. Xulrunner is the interpreter of xul code in gecko, the language dinterface of firefox and also of web or local applications. It is used in the firefox browser, the thunderbird email client, and many other projects. July 31, 2017 20 comments i was sitting at home writing future articles for ghacks and i decided on a spur of the moment whim that i wanted to try out a distribution i had never touched before.
Create your free github account today to subscribe to this repository for new releases and build software alongside 40 million developers. To launch latest version of firefox browser using selnium 3, we need to set a system property webdriver. In firefox 5761, the progress bar is a thin line below the download arrow on the downloads toolbar button. That should help determine whether it is safe to close firefox. Since i am a great fan of firefox for a long time, i wanted firefox s perspective and not windows perspective. A recent change marks the beginning of the integration of openh264 in the firefox browser. Mar 05, 2019 this could eventually turn into a bad situation like we had with ie6, but hopefully chromium remains standards compliant and the competition from firefox and safari can keep development fast and. Feb 25, 2019 the firefox, until recently was using an ageold gecko engine to display the content.
Sep 28, 2016 mozilla is removing firefox os code from the gecko engine. Want to be notified of new releases in mozillagecko dev. Airfox is a fast, consistent, reliable, secure, private and independent web browser. Some advanced features such as reliable download manager are not available due to restrictions from the. It translates calls into the marionette automation protocol by acting as a proxy between the local and remote ends. In 2017, firefox began incorporating new technology under the code name quantum to promote parallelism and a more intuitive user interface. Firefox nightly, currently on version 33, will list the codec now under plugins if a switch is flipped in the browsers configuration. A look at opensuse based gecko linux ghacks tech news. Implement and enable pointer events andor touchaction. Firefox focus is switching from chrome webview to the. I wanted to be sure it woudl not conflict with firefox in any way such as with updating, etc. Selenium 3 launching firefox browser using geckodriver. Apr 02, 2020 how to work offline in mozilla firefox. The gecko sdk, also known as the xulrunner sdk, is a set of xpidl files, headers and tools to develop xpcom components which can then in turn e.
Security researcher nils discovered a mechanism to break out of the gecko media plugin gmp sandbox on windows systems. Note that in order to develop such components, you do not need the full sources of e. In single process configuration of desktop firefox, which. Switching to geckoview will give focus the benefits of geckos quantum improvements and enables mozilla to implement unique privacyenhancing features in the future, such as reducing the potential of third party. In mozillas early days, internet explorer had 95% of the browser market an. Gecko is a web browser engine used in many applications developed by mozilla foundation and the mozilla corporation notably the firefox web browser including its mobile version other than ios devices.
Firefox, since you do not access parts of the front end from within a. Geckofx at the link i provided above is at version 45, does this mean that it uses the firefox gecko from version 45. Selenium has launched selenium 3 and if you are using firefox latest version then you may face some issues. There are several reasons this is infeasible or undesirable. Entering and exiting offline mode is done simply by going to settings. It has tighter integration with firefox than external profilers, and has more of a platform focus than the devtools performance panel. If the user updates firefox does this effect my embedded control at all. One of the mozilla employees over on rfirefox mentioned that focus has a clear distinction between the ui and the rendering engine geckoview while fennec firefox for android does not gecko. There are a number of components to the web browser with the parts we interact with simply being the user interface for it.
New firefox focus comes with search suggestions, revamped visual design and an underthehood surprise for android users. This means it is a little bit behind the current firefox version my firefox shows 52. Why mozilla is committed to gecko as webkit popularity. Is this just one person who has ported firefoxs gecko the layout engine to be able to used by. And for recent versions of firefox, we have to download the driver and define it using system. Firefox focus is moving from webview to the gecko engine. The following four sections tell the developer how to download and. Implement css device adaptation to rationalize mobile viewport code. Quantum project based on a crazy fast servo engine revamped firefox completely since version 60. Gecko is the html display engine, and also the browser of firefox os, while gaia is the user interface. Marionette the next generation of firefoxdriver is turned on by default from selenium 3.
On windows, to show the classic menu bar file, edit, view. The firefox, until recently was using an ageold gecko engine to display the content. Hi jenkweb, what version of firefox do you have currently. The following table shows the various versions of gecko and what versions of common applications are based on them. Gecko media plugin sandbox escape announced january, 2015 reporter nils impact critical products firefox fixed in. Net runtime environment, airfox uses the gecko engine also seen in some wellknown browsers such as firefox, waterfox, pale moon. Gecko driver launching firefox browser in selenium 3. I am aware that selenium supported old firefox version by default without a driver. Geckofx is based on the same engine as firefox, the mozilla gecko. Tabs on top are fine, but it looks even better with the tabs on the bottom. Just download firefox from the links given below and run the installer. During the writing of this, the last available version was the geckofx29. Will firefox ever drop its gecko layout engine to adopt. Gecko versions and application versions mozilla mdn.
Why mozilla is committed to gecko as webkit popularity grows. The installation, more or less, is almost automatic. To visualize how a web page is layered, turn on the pref layers. Mozillas boot to gecko the web is the platform mozilla. I was in the middle of my degree in ux at the time and having a stable, fast and reliable browser with the support for new tech was a lifesaver during this time. Find related downloads to gecko browser freeware and softwares, download kmeleon, spark baidu browser, torch browser, tor browser, avant browser, maxthon cloud browser, opera, tuneup utilities, inter. Launch firefox with geckodriver latest automationtestinghub. Firefox addons and the firefox addon manager tells gecko where to look for plugins, using the mozigeckomediapluginservice.
Firefox uses the gecko layout engine to render web pages, which implements current and anticipated web standards. Mozilla firefox 3 release candidate 2 release notes. This could eventually turn into a bad situation like we had with ie6, but hopefully chromium remains standards compliant and the competition from firefox and safari can keep development fast and. Oct 02, 2018 well make sure to keep you updated on the progress as well as all new developments around firefox focus on this blog and are looking forward to your feedback. Firefox os was first introduced back in 2012 and a lot of us here at xda have had a soft spot for the platform. Even if you are working with older versions of firefox browser, selenium 3 expects you to set path to the driver executable by the webdriver. Net or is this something official or more or less official. Thats why with the help of dedicated volunteers around the world we make the firefox browser available in more than 90 languages.
Firefox focus is switching from chrome webview to the gecko engine. Firefox mobile is, iiuc, fancy chrome wrapping around the underlying gecko. This can be done in two ways as depicted in the below image check if firefox is 32bit or 64bit. Firefox for mobile uses the same gecko layout engine as mozilla firefox. Gecko is designed to support open internet standards, and is used by different applications to display web pages and, in some cases, an applications user interface itself by rendering xul. Gecko received a massive overhaul for firefox 3, with countless changes that significantly improved the entire browsing experience. Firefox, openh264, gecko media plugins, and current state of development. I do very much appreciate your very fast reply and time. Firefox, since you do not access parts of the front end from within a component. A look at opensuse based gecko linux by mike turcottemccusker on august 06, 2017 in linux last update.
It can be used in a variety of situations where external profilers are not available, and can provide more information and insight into what the browser is. Firefox, openh264, gecko media plugins, and current state. A proxy for using w3c webdrivercompatible clients to interact with geckobased browsers. Important to note that the apps will not be b2gs cubs they will be plain html, css, and javascript apps. Migrations are generally quite lengthy and cumbersome. Firefox focus is switching from chrome webview to the gecko. The firefox profiler is a profiler that is built into firefox and is available at profiler.
While a download is in progress, the firefox icon on the windows taskbar will have partial shading. Mozilla is removing firefox os code from the gecko engine. In gecko, the docshell is the toplevel object responsible for managing. This persona and all others, doesnt look good with the menu bar hidden. Based on whether your firefox is 32bit or 64bit, you need to. Dec 05, 2018 selenium has launched selenium 3 and if you are using firefox latest version then you may face some issues.
35 725 921 275 498 328 700 1123 765 760 1149 1376 49 589 733 1207 1024 1262 929 936 575 1409 745 949 1477 289 1492 1232 697 1098 681 591 467 378 663 296 675 282 XML HTML